str_test=input()number,chars,others=0,0,0# 分别统计数字、字母个数# 使用循环进行判断print(str_...
ifvalidation data is provided.Subclasses should overrideforany actions to run.Arguments:batch:Integer,indexofbatch within the current epoch.logs:Dict,contains thereturnvalueof`model.test_step`.Typically,the valuesofthe`
5,8),param(1,2,3),param(2,2,4)])deftest_add(self,num1,num2,total):c=Calculator()result=c.add(num1,num2)self.assertEqual(result,total)if__name__=='__main__':unittest.main()
if date in mt: withopen("e:\\test\\result.txt",'a',encoding="utf-8") as fp1: fp1.write(str(mt)) print(mt) 此处需要注意,由于是放在for循环中,多次打开文档,所以打开文档写入模式,应该是“a”追加写。否则每次只能保存一个数据比对结果。 并且,调试程序的时候,应该每次执行前都删掉result.txt文...
常用参数: argnames:参数名 argvalues:参数对应值,类型必须为list 当参数为一个时格式:[value] 当参数个数大于一个时,格式为:[(param_value1,param_value2...),(param_value1,param_value2...)] 使用方法: @pytest.mark.parametrize(argnames,argvalues) ️ 参数值为N个,测试方法就会运行N次单个参数...
1)CSV也是文本文件的一种,除了CSV之外,其他由空格或制表符分隔的list数据通常存储在各种type的文本文件中(扩展名通常为.txt)。 5.3 读取CSV或文本文件中的data (2025/5/4 18:21) 大多数情况下,对data analyst,最常执行的操作是从CSV文件或其他type的文本文件中读取data。 为了弄清楚pandas处理这类data的方法,...
dict= {}#用于存放“数字及出现次数”的键值对list2 = []#用于存放重复次数比较多的数字foriinlist: dict[i]= list.count(i)#统计当前元素的个数,并以键值对形式存放到字典print(dict.items())#dict.items()返回键值元组的列表,x[1]根据值value排序,x[0]根据键key排序new_list = sorted(dict.items(...
acclist.insert() (要插入的位置,插入的内容) list插入内容 acclist.remove(value) 指要删除的list中的内容(找到的第一个value) acclist.count(‘value’) 查找list中有多少个value acclist[4] = ‘value’ 更改某个位置的元素 acclist.pop() 移除list中最后一个value(删除第8个用:acclist.pop(8)) ...
in写在if python python if i in range 1.range()是一个函数 for i in range () 就是给i赋值: 比如for i in range (1,3): 就是把1,2依次赋值给i range () 函数的使用是这样的: range(start, stop[, step]),分别是起始、终止和步长
print(list(map(str, range(5))) print(list(map(len, ['abc', '1234', 'test']))) # 使用operator标准库中的add运算add运算相当于运算符+ # 如果map()函数的第一个参数func能够接收两个参数,则可以映射到两个序列上 for num in map(add, range(5), range(5,10)): print...